I just binge watched "Shannons - End of an Era" on youtube
Its brilliant really worth watching 4 x 45 minute episodes about the rise glory and demise of Aust auto manufacturing. maybe just watch the first 3 eps The last episode is a bit of a horror movie and left me with a lump in my throat and tears running down my cheeks. https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=5tC7yP9LmAE |
